Personal Stories and the Playground Philosophy

In my early years, I discovered the profound joy of movement by simply playing. I remember balancing on narrow beams, hopping over rocks, and inventing games that challenged my agility and wit. These childhood experiences laid the foundation for my lifelong passion for movement and the brain-body connection.

As I grew older, I continued to explore unconventional ways to maintain my health. I built balance boards, practiced juggling, and even developed a routine of barefoot walking on uneven surfaces. These activities not only honed my physical skills but also enhanced my cognitive flexibility. I realized that play was not just a pastime but a crucial element of a vibrant life.

Specific Exercises for Lifelong Vitality

Balance Beam Walking

Create a simple balance beam in your backyard or living room. Use a 2x4 piece of wood or a chalk-drawn line. Practice walking forward, backward, and sideways. Challenge yourself by closing your eyes or balancing on one foot at a time.

Juggling

Juggling is a fantastic way to enhance hand-eye coordination and cognitive speed. Start with one ball and gradually add more as you become comfortable. Incorporate different sizes and weights to increase the challenge.

Barefoot Walking

Take off your shoes and walk on grass, gravel, or sand. This practice strengthens your feet, improves balance, and provides a sensory experience that stimulates the brain.
